Thief of Bagdad: Piecemeal Masterpiece — 26 weeks ago

WORTH CONSUMING!

Thief of Bagdad was helmed by six different directors over the course of its filming, but you wouldn’t know it to watch it: it appears absolutely seamless. It’s a little melodramatic and over the top, but the copious amounts of fun and adventure keep it from falling flat. It soars mostly because of its special effects, which are primitive by today’s standards but are still beautiful: the scene where Sabu is trapped in the spiderweb was a particular highlight. What surprised me the most was how much Disney’s Aladdin ‘homaged’ from this movie: some of the characters, some of the plot points, even the set design. Parts of the “One Jump Ahead” song were lifted almost frame for frame. I know it’s an adaptation of an old story, but the fact that the innovations and alterations made for this movie made it over to the animated one shows how influential this movie was. Not just a good movie, but a fascinating piece of film history.
